Will Santa be given the sack?

Santa Claus was at the centre of a new row after it was announced that his staff had lost the names of billions of children who had been naughty or nice over the last year.

However, Santa said that he was confident that the risk of naughty children being able to fraudulently claim presents by using the identity of those who had been nice was extremely unlikely. "Although we do not know where these details are, we are confident that they are still in the North Pole" a spokeself announced today.

However, calls for Santa's resignation are growing. Tony Blair, former popular Prime Minister who recently saw his support by illegally invading Iraq, led the calls for Father Christmas to be given the "sack". Asked if he was interested in the position, Blair refused to rule himself out. "Only when you have been universally adored can you have the humility to suppose that you might be able to fill such a role"
